Your Guide to a Thriving Vertical Garden System
Want to grow more plants in less space? A vertical garden system is your answer! These clever setups let you plant upwards, bringing greenery to balconies, patios, or even indoor walls. Let’s dive into what makes a great vertical garden system.
What to Look For: Key Features of a Great Vertical Garden System
When you’re picking out a vertical garden system, keep these important features in mind:
- Modular Design: Can you add more sections later? This lets your garden grow with you.
- Watering System: Some systems have built-in watering. This makes plant care much easier. Look for drip irrigation or self-watering features.
- Drainage: Good drainage stops plants from getting too wet and rotting. Make sure excess water can escape.
- Durability: Will it last for a long time? Choose a system built with strong materials.
- Ease of Assembly: You don’t want to spend hours putting it together. Simple instructions and quick setup are best.
Important Materials: What Your Vertical Garden is Made Of
The materials used affect how long your system lasts and how it looks. Here are common ones:
- Recycled Plastic: This is a popular choice. It’s lightweight, strong, and good for the environment.
- Fabric Pockets: Some systems use durable fabric bags. These allow good air flow for roots.
- Metal Frames: Metal can make a system very sturdy. It’s often used for larger or freestanding units.
- Ceramic or Terracotta Pots: These look nice and are good for individual plant containers. They can be heavier.
Quality Matters: What Makes a Vertical Garden Great (or Not So Great)
Several things can make a vertical garden system better or worse.
Factors That Improve Quality:
- UV Resistance: If your garden is outside, it needs to handle sunlight. UV-resistant materials won’t fade or break down.
- Strong Construction: A well-built system won’t wobble or fall apart.
- Smart Watering: Even watering prevents dry spots and keeps all plants happy.
- Good Drainage Holes: This is super important for healthy roots.
Factors That Reduce Quality:
- Cheap Plastic: It can become brittle and crack in the sun.
- Poor Drainage: Plants will struggle and might die.
- Difficult Assembly: Frustration can ruin the fun of gardening.
- Flimsy Design: It might not hold up to wind or the weight of plants and soil.
User Experience and Use Cases: How You’ll Use Your Vertical Garden
Think about how you plan to use your vertical garden. This helps you choose the right type.
- Balcony Gardeners: Small, wall-mounted systems are perfect for limited space. Grow herbs, lettuce, or small flowers.
- Patio Decorators: Larger, freestanding units can add a beautiful green wall to your outdoor living area. Grow a mix of flowers and edibles.
- Indoor Growers: Some systems come with grow lights, ideal for bringing fresh herbs and greens into your kitchen year-round.
- Busy People: Look for systems with self-watering features. They save you time and worry.
- Beginner Gardeners: Simple, easy-to-assemble kits with clear instructions will make your first vertical garden a success.
